Introduction to Promotional Products in Educational Settings
Promotional products are a game-changer in education, boosting brand visibility. They help increase awareness, build loyalty, and support fundraising. Schools can greatly benefit from these items, as the industry makes over $20 billion a year3.
Most people remember the brand of a promotional item they got in the last two years, showing their power3. This is key in schools where staying visible and engaged is crucial. Plus, 85% of people start doing business with a brand after getting a promotional item3.
There's a big push for eco-friendly products, with 78% of distributors seeing a rise in demand4. Schools can use this trend to promote sustainability. Also, 82% of suppliers offer custom options, making items unique for students and staff4.
Promotional items are a big part of daily life. For example, 91% of people have a promotional item in their kitchen, and 76% remember the brand3. In schools, this means better visibility as students and parents use these items often, keeping the school in their minds.
Using promotional merchandise helps schools stay positive and visible. Almost three-quarters of people remember the company behind a promotional item3. This makes these products a smart way to strengthen a school's identity and engage with the community.

The Impact of Logo Imprinted Giveaways
Wearing custom branded clothes like t-shirts and hats can make a school more recognizable by up to 83% among students and staff5. Branded water bottles can help students drink more water, making the school a healthier place5. Personalized backpacks and totes also boost community awareness by 70%5. These items do more than just look good; they create a sense of belonging among everyone at the school6.

The Role of Promotional Products in Admissions
In the competitive world of school admissions, using promotional items can really help. These items make a big impact, especially at open days and fairs.
Promotional products are key in this process. For example, the U.S. college store market is worth about $10 billion. This shows how much students and families want college-branded items11. With a 33% increase in students since 2000, good marketing is more important than ever11.
Using school-branded items like custom banners is a smart move. They show off the school's colors and logo, grabbing the attention of potential students12. Direct mail postcards also work well, helping people remember important dates and info12.
Also, 79% of colleges think direct marketing is very effective. It gets people to visit campus or apply11. Using school marketing products in materials like info packets with branded giveaways helps share school info better12.
With over 20,000 colleges out there, using targeted marketing can help a school stand out11. Updating websites and printing calendars for shadow days also engages potential students more12.

The Timing of Distributing Promotional Merchandise
In the world of school promotions, getting the timing right is key. Studies show that almost 96% of people want to know about promotions ahead of time24. This means planning and telling people early is crucial for getting their attention. It's best to give out items before big school events, sports seasons, and important academic moments.
About 81% of people keep promotional items for over a year, showing their lasting value24. Schools can use big events and season changes to give out items. This helps get the word out and gets students involved.
Promotional items work well for 70% of brands, making their marketing goals24. For example, giving out branded items at the start of school can make everyone feel more connected.
